Software Specifications
IEEE compliance
The BigIron RX Series switch supports the following standards:
•
802.1d Bridging
•
802.1q VLAN Tagging
•
802.1w Rapid Spanning Tree (RSTP)
•
802.1x User Authentication
•
802.3, 10BaseT
•
802.3ad Link Aggregation
•
802.3ae 10000BaseX
•
802.3u, 100BaseTX, 100BaseFX
•
802.3z 1000BaseSX, 1000BaseLX
•
802.3x Flow Control
RFC support
The following sections list the RFCs supported by the BigIron RX Series switch.
General protocols
•
791 – Internet Protocol (IP)
•
792 – Internet Control Message Protocol (ICMP)
•
793 – Transmission Control Protocol (TCP)
•
783 – Trivial File Transfer Protocol (TFTP)
•
768 – User Datagram Protocol (UDP)
•
826 – Ethernet Address Resolution Protocol (ARP)
•
854, 855, and 857 – TELNET
•
894 – IP over Ethernet
•
903 – RARP
•
906 – Bootstrap loading using TFTP
•
919 – Broadcast Internet datagrams
•
920 – Domain requirements
•
922 – Broadcast Internet datagrams in the presence of subnets
•
950 – Internet standard subnetting procedure
